Dr. Rajender Kumar has been serving as the Secretary of Hindi Vishva Bharati since March 2024. After assuming office, he took several significant initiatives to strengthen the institutional framework and academic outreach of the organization. Under his leadership, the institute was successfully registered with NITI Aayog, ensuring its recognition at the national level. He also obtained the ISSN number (3048-5266) for the research journal Vishvambhara, thereby enhancing its academic credibility and visibility.

As the Editor, Dr. Kumar has so far edited five consecutive issues of Vishvambhara, maintaining high scholarly standards and expanding its thematic scope. His dedicated efforts have contributed to the journal’s steady progress and growing reputation in the field of social sciences, humanities, art and culture. His commitment continues as he works to further enrich and professionalize the publication.

Under the banner of Hindi Vishva Bharati, Dr. Kumar has launched a new project (Prakalp) titled “Bikaner Through the Ages”, which focuses on highlighting lesser known aspects of Bikaner’s historical, cultural and intellectual heritage.

As part of this ongoing project, a special lecture was delivered on September 6, 2025, by Professor S.K. Bhanot, a former Dean and Head of the Department of History at Maharaja Ganga Singh University, Bikaner. The lecture was titled “1857 का प्रथम स्वाधीनता संग्राम एवं बीकानेर.” The lecture provided insight into the historical events related to 1857 in Bikaner State and emphasized the need for further research in regional history.
